#include "sync/engine/download.h"
#include <string>
#include "sync/engine/syncer_proto_util.h"
#include "sync/sessions/sync_session.h"
#include "sync/sessions/sync_session_context.h"
#include "sync/syncable/directory.h"
#include "sync/syncable/nigori_handler.h"
#include "sync/syncable/syncable_read_transaction.h"
namespace syncer {
using sessions::StatusController;
using sessions::SyncSession;
using sessions::SyncSessionContext;
using std::string;
namespace {
SyncerError HandleGetEncryptionKeyResponse(
const sync_pb::ClientToServerResponse& update_response,
syncable::Directory* dir) {
bool success = false;
if (update_response.get_updates().encryption_keys_size() == 0) {
LOG(ERROR) << "Failed to receive encryption key from server.";
return SERVER_RESPONSE_VALIDATION_FAILED;
}
syncable::ReadTransaction trans(FROM_HERE, dir);
syncable::NigoriHandler* nigori_handler = dir->GetNigoriHandler();
success = nigori_handler->SetKeystoreKeys(
update_response.get_updates().encryption_keys(),
&trans);
DVLOG(1) << "GetUpdates returned "
<< update_response.get_updates().encryption_keys_size()
<< "encryption keys. Nigori keystore key "
<< (success ? "" : "not ") << "updated.";
return (success ? SYNCER_OK : SERVER_RESPONSE_VALIDATION_FAILED);
}
bool ShouldRequestEncryptionKey(
SyncSessionContext* context) {
bool need_encryption_key = false;
if (context->keystore_encryption_enabled()) {
syncable::Directory* dir = context->directory();
syncable::ReadTransaction trans(FROM_HERE, dir);
syncable::NigoriHandler* nigori_handler = dir->GetNigoriHandler();
need_encryption_key = nigori_handler->NeedKeystoreKey(&trans);
}
return need_encryption_key;
}
} // namespace
namespace download {
void InitDownloadUpdatesContext(
SyncSession* session,
bool create_mobile_bookmarks_folder,
sync_pb::ClientToServerMessage* message) {
message->set_share(session->context()->account_name());
message->set_message_contents(sync_pb::ClientToServerMessage::GET_UPDATES);
sync_pb::GetUpdatesMessage* get_updates = message->mutable_get_updates();
// We want folders for our associated types, always. If we were to set
// this to false, the server would send just the non-container items
// (e.g. Bookmark URLs but not their containing folders).
get_updates->set_fetch_folders(true);
get_updates->set_create_mobile_bookmarks_folder(
create_mobile_bookmarks_folder);
bool need_encryption_key = ShouldRequestEncryptionKey(session->context());
get_updates->set_need_encryption_key(need_encryption_key);
// Set legacy GetUpdatesMessage.GetUpdatesCallerInfo information.
get_updates->mutable_caller_info()->set_notifications_enabled(
session->context()->notifications_enabled());
}
SyncerError ExecuteDownloadUpdates(
ModelTypeSet request_types,
SyncSession* session,
GetUpdatesProcessor* get_updates_processor,
sync_pb::ClientToServerMessage* msg) {
sync_pb::ClientToServerResponse update_response;
StatusController* status = session->mutable_status_controller();
bool need_encryption_key = ShouldRequestEncryptionKey(session->context());
if (session->context()->debug_info_getter()) {
sync_pb::DebugInfo* debug_info = msg->mutable_debug_info();
CopyClientDebugInfo(session->context()->debug_info_getter(), debug_info);
}
SyncerError result = SyncerProtoUtil::PostClientToServerMessage(
msg,
&update_response,
session);
DVLOG(2) << SyncerProtoUtil::ClientToServerResponseDebugString(
update_response);
if (result != SYNCER_OK) {
LOG(ERROR) << "PostClientToServerMessage() failed during GetUpdates";
return result;
}
DVLOG(1) << "GetUpdates "
<< " returned " << update_response.get_updates().entries_size()
<< " updates and indicated "
<< update_response.get_updates().changes_remaining()
<< " updates left on server.";
if (session->context()->debug_info_getter()) {
// Clear debug info now that we have successfully sent it to the server.
DVLOG(1) << "Clearing client debug info.";
session->context()->debug_info_getter()->ClearDebugInfo();
}
if (need_encryption_key ||
update_response.get_updates().encryption_keys_size() > 0) {
syncable::Directory* dir = session->context()->directory();
status->set_last_get_key_result(
HandleGetEncryptionKeyResponse(update_response, dir));
}
return ProcessResponse(update_response.get_updates(),
request_types,
get_updates_processor,
status);
}
SyncerError ProcessResponse(
const sync_pb::GetUpdatesResponse& gu_response,
ModelTypeSet request_types,
GetUpdatesProcessor* get_updates_processor,
StatusController* status) {
status->increment_num_updates_downloaded_by(gu_response.entries_size());
// The changes remaining field is used to prevent the client from looping. If
// that field is being set incorrectly, we're in big trouble.
if (!gu_response.has_changes_remaining()) {
return SERVER_RESPONSE_VALIDATION_FAILED;
}
status->set_num_server_changes_remaining(gu_response.changes_remaining());
if (!get_updates_processor->ProcessGetUpdatesResponse(request_types,
gu_response,
status)) {
return SERVER_RESPONSE_VALIDATION_FAILED;
}
if (gu_response.changes_remaining() == 0) {
return SYNCER_OK;
} else {
return SERVER_MORE_TO_DOWNLOAD;
}
}
void CopyClientDebugInfo(
sessions::DebugInfoGetter* debug_info_getter,
sync_pb::DebugInfo* debug_info) {
DVLOG(1) << "Copying client debug info to send.";
debug_info_getter->GetDebugInfo(debug_info);
}
} // namespace download
} // namespace syncer
